Grainville School is a thriving 11-16 inclusive secondary school in the central part of the beautiful Jersey. During recent years Grainville has gone through an extensive building programme. Our new school facilities are therefore spacious and modern, equipped with the latest technology to enhance learning. Students at Key Stage 3 follow a broad and balanced curriculum. At Key Stage 4 we offer a wide range of subjects and options blending traditional GCSE and BTEC vocational courses.
